I don't think I've ever seen an NCO wearing the drivers badge unless they were in a transportation unit or worked in the motor pool. I know I never wore mine. I certainly never saw anyone at Group wear theirs.
Short answer to your questions:
Left pocket flap from the center of the jacket out: master blaster, MFF, weapons qual (MFF and Master wings can be swapped )
left side above the pocket: individual awards w/ CIB on top
right side above the pocket: unit awards w/ foreign jump wings above and SF Crest above that
If you decide to put the driver badge on:
Left pocket flap from the center of the jacket out: MFF, driver's badge, weapons qual
left side above the pocket from bottom to top: individual awards, master blaster, CIB
right side above the pocket: unit awards w/ foreign jump wings above and SF Crest above that
Did you buy a new dress green jacket? If so, you'll want to make sure you have the correct number of service stripes and overseas stripes on the sleeves.
Given that this is for a shadow box and not for wear, I'd put the flash behind the jump wings and the SF DUI on the tabs (epaulets) so the uniform looks like it did when he was active. He'll know he has to take them off if he ever wears it.
